American Composers Forum

Mission

The American Composers Forum enriches lives by nurturing the creative spirit of composers and communities. We provide new opportunities for composers and their music to flourish, and engage communities in the creation, performance and enjoyment of music.

Programs

The American Composers Forum has established itself as a leader in the field of new music.  It has built its reputation upon the ability to initiate collaborations that nurture creativity and build community.  The Forum’s primary vision is to facilitate an ecosystem of creativity where composers and the communities they work with supply one another with the equipment and methods necessary to meet their each other’s needs.   

New initiatives continue to serve artists in a variety of ways, from readings and contests to workshops on pressing issues.  Our educational endeavors are reinforcing existing music curriculums, and providing essential instruction to schools where budgetary restraints have meant the loss of formal music programs.  Composer residencies continue to bring new music into the lives of thousands of community members, who are energized by their inclusion in the creative process.
